WebApr 2, 2024 · There are Two Formulas to calculate Year-Over-Year Growth Rate. Both provide the same output. Formula 01: Year-Over-Year Growth = ( Current Period Amount / Previous Period Amount ) – 1 Formula 02: Year-Over-Year Growth = ( Current Period Amount – Previous Period Amount ) / Previous Period Amount x 100 Formula to …
